Active recalls showing 1 of 1

severe NHTSA 18V775000 November 1, 2018

Ford Motor Company (Ford) is recalling certain 2010 Ford Fusion, Mercury Milan and 2010-2012 Lincoln MKZ vehicles that previously received a replacement passenger air bag under recall 16V-384, 17V-024 or 18V-046

If the air bag does not inflate as intended, there is an increased risk of injury in the event of a crash.

Fix: Ford will notify owners, and dealers will replace the passenger air bag module, free of charge. The recall began November 21, 2018. Owners may contact Ford customer service at 1-866-436-7332. Ford's number for this recall is 18S34.

What's the most common problem on the 2012 Lincoln MKZ?

Based on NHTSA records, the most-reported issue is airbags, with 68 complaints filed. Typical failure occurs around 46,084 miles. Average repair cost runs about $1,100 at an independent shop.

How do I check if my Lincoln MKZ has open recalls?

Paste your VIN into the decoder at the top of this page. We pull live from NHTSA, so you'll see exactly which campaigns apply to your vehicle and whether the dealer has logged the fix. Recall repairs are always free regardless of mileage or warranty status.
